The Problem with Movement: Warping and Shrinking
To understand the benefits of steel, we first have to look at the challenges of traditional materials. Timber is a hygroscopic material, which means it behaves like a sponge. It absorbs moisture from the humid Australian air and releases it during the dry seasons. This constant cycle of absorption and evaporation causes the wood to swell, shrink, twist, and bow. In a kit home context, this movement can be a nightmare for an owner builder.
When a frame moves, it doesn't move in isolation. It takes everything else with it. As timber studs shrink, they pull away from the plasterboard, leading to unsightly nail pops and cracks in your cornices. When a plate warps, it can cause your flooring to become uneven or create gaps in your insulation. By choosing steel frame construction, you are eliminating these variables from the very beginning. Steel is inorganic. It does not contain moisture, and it does not react to humidity. A steel stud is the exact same shape and size when it arrives on your site as it will be twenty years after you move in.

Why Straight Walls Matter for Your Interior Finish
A home is often judged by its finish, but a high quality finish is only possible if the bones of the house are straight. Professional tradespeople, such as vertical tilers and plasterers, love working on steel frame kit homes because the surface they are working on is uniform and stable.
Imagine laying expensive large format tiles in your new bathroom. If the framing behind the wall shrinks or twists even slightly, it can cause the waterproof membrane to stress or the tiles to crack at the grout lines. Steel frames provide a rigid, unchanging substrate. This means your paint jobs stay smooth, your wallpaper stays flat, and your tiling remains pristine. For an owner builder who is perhaps doing some of the interior work themselves, having a perfectly straight wall to work with makes the DIY process significantly easier and more professional looking.
The Environmental Advantage: Standing Up to Australian Extremes
Australia is a land of extremes. From the tropical humidity of Queensland to the dry heat of the Victorian summer, our homes are under constant environmental pressure. Steel frames are uniquely suited to this landscape because they are unaffected by these shifts. While timber may groan and creak as it expands and contracts during a cold night after a hot day, steel remains silent and stable.
Furthermore, the dimensional stability of steel offers a hidden benefit: termite resistance. Because steel frames are not an organic food source, you don't have to worry about the structural integrity of your home being compromised by pests. This provides immense peace of mind for homeowners in high risk termite zones, knowing that the skeleton of their house is invincible to such threats.
Practical Tips for Owner Builders Working with Steel Frames
If you are considering a steel frame kit home, here are some practical tips to help you get the most out of this superior material:
- Trust the Plan: Because steel frames are pre engineered, don't try to modify them on site. The strength of the system relies on the design. If you need a change, consult with your kit provider before you start assembly.
- Use the Right Fasteners: Steel frames require specific screws and fasteners. Your kit will typically include these, but always ensure you are using the recommended tools, like a high quality impact driver, to make the assembly process smooth.
- Appreciate the Lightness: Steel has a very high strength to weight ratio. This makes the frames easier to manhandle on site compared to heavy, wet timber. It reduces fatigue for the owner builder and makes the assembly process faster.
- Service Holes are Pre-Punched: One of the best features of steel frames is that holes for electrical wiring and plumbing are usually pre-punched. This saves you hours of drilling and ensures that your services are run neatly through the centre of the studs, maintaining the structural integrity of the wall.
The Long Term Value of Stability
Building a kit home is a significant investment of time and resources. When you look at the long term maintenance of a property, steel frame homes consistently outperform their counterparts. Because the structure does not settle or shift due to moisture loss, you will spend significantly less time and money on maintenance tasks like patching plaster cracks, re-aligning doors, or fixing sticking windows.
This stability also contributes to the overall energy efficiency of the home. When a frame shifts, it can create tiny gaps around window frames and door seals, leading to air drafts that make your heating and cooling systems work harder. A stable steel frame maintains the tight envelope of the building, helping your insulation do its job effectively and keeping your energy bills lower.
